Job Description:
Supports the business by performing professional level Human Resources responsibilities involving one or more operational areas such as employment, benefits administration, employee/labor relations, training, HRIS, legal & regulatory compliance. Receives and acts on employee complaints or grievances, administers employee records, ensures compliance with labor laws and regulations, recommends and coordinates employee training activities and administers compensation, benefits and performance programs. Works with employees and managers to address root causes of human resources and employee relations issues.
